# Env file — Cartwheel dispatch, driver-assignment heuristic
# Scope: staging only. Do not promote to prod.
# The heuristic weights (proximity, shift balance, refusal rate) are tuned
# for the Velmont pilot region and will misbehave elsewhere.
# Review notes: heuristic service runs unprivileged; it reads weights
# read-only from the tuning store and writes nothing back.
# Only one sensitive value exists in this file: the tuning-store access
# credential, consumed at boot and never logged.
# That credential is set on the following line.

secret setting of faduf-bahop: LEDGER_TOKEN8=c3b363be

Hi Dovra,

Handing over the score sheets from the Kestrel Bay regional chess final — all 84 boards, signed and sleeved. Tomas from the arbiter panel wants them at the federation office by Monday, so please slot them into tomorrow's morning run. They're in the grey folder on my desk. The courier hand-over instruction follows below.

courier memo of tawep-tajep: the quenius ulaiel courier leaves the fenir ledger at gate 9128 under passcode 527513

Subject: FY Training Budget — handover detail

Dear executive team, and especially our incoming director,

I have finalized next year's training budget for Ashgrove Dynamics at a modest increase over this year. Allocations favor the Kestrel certification track and the new Leadership Foundations cohort in Bramleigh. Detailed line items and vendor comparisons are attached for review before approval. One sensitive consideration shaped these numbers, and it is recorded in the note below.

internal memo for kawip-hadug: Headcount on the Wenwyn team goes from 7 to 140 by the end of January. Gross margin on Wenwyn came in at 20 percent against a plan of 15 percent.